They are seeking to recruit a Construction Estimator who will have experience in all types of construction and will have held a senior post within a leading construction company, having being responsible for the production of full accurate estimates to Design and Build contracts to all formats including BOQ’s SOR’s SMMT, Cost Plan and detailed estimate breakdowns. This position is to manage / produce accurate and detailed Building /Construction package estimates. The candidate will have a wide range of experience across all aspects of Construction and Civils works. The candidate will ideally be able to survey and measure completed packages and develop detailed cost plans and estimates in D&B opportunities for our accounts. Key responsibilities are as follows: Maximise and bring to the attention of the directors any beneficial information that may arise during the tender period. Carefully vet all quotations to ensure that they fully comply with the specification. Arrange for a site visit where necessary and liaise with the contracting department. Ensure that tender documentation is kept in a safe place and secure manner and that no original data is removed. Materials to be archived in accordance with laid down procedures. Prepare schedules of rates when requested within timescales laid down and where possible to the advantage of the company. Review tender documents and drawings Responsible for preparing, managing and taking accountability for the development of cost estimates in support of project and business objectives. To create detailed cost risk analysis and work breakdown analysis to ensure the production of high quality cost estimates.
